    Account Protector

    Account Protector

    An MT4/MT5 expert advisor to protect accounts from losses.

    Account Protector is a MetaTrader expert advisor that allows you to define a range of conditions (for example, total loss exceeding some percentage of your account) and a list of actions (for example, close all trades) that will be executed when one of those conditions is triggered.

    Metatrader API Bridge Server

    Metatrader API Bridge Server

    Metatrader API Bridge

    ...A REST API communication between Metatrader forex trading platform and an external application, such as the Forex General integrated trading environment. In 2010, Forex General was released an the first trading platform with a metatrader bridge. The original bridge was a DLL loaded via a Metatrader expert advisor, but several antivirus programs reported the DLL as a virus and blocked execution because a shared DATA segment was being used. Using NodeJS, the Metatrader bridge has been moved into a standalone REST API server without the use of a shared DATA segment. Forex General (https://sourceforge.net/p/forex-general) includes the Metatrader API Bridge Server within the application.
